Fools Garden Festival Returns to Pforzheim in 2024 with Star-Studded Lineup

Get ready for a musical extravaganza as the much-anticipated Fools Garden Festival is set to return to Pforzheim, Germany next year. The three-day event, taking place from Friday, August 2, to Sunday, August 4, 2024, will feature an impressive lineup of artists, bands, and musicians, all with a connection to the popular pop band.

The festival kicks off on Friday, August 2, at the CongressCentrum, where the Grammy-winning SWR Big Band and the Southwest German Chamber Orchestra will perform. The charity gala, organised in collaboration with the "Water is Right" foundation and "People in Need," will also take place on this day.

On the same day, the CongressCentrum will also host several other artists, including Fools Garden themselves, who will perform as part of their three-day festival in Pforzheim in August 2024.

Moving on to Sunday, August 4, 2024, the action shifts to Kulturhaus Osterfeld, where a host of talented artists will take the stage. Highlights include Alfons, Ingo Oschmann, Eure Muetter, Die Hoehner, Stumpes Zieh und Zupf Kapelle, 3 Miles to Essex, and John Flemming Olson, among others. The day will also see performances by Jean Jacques Kravetz, Dieter Thomas Kuhn, Norman Keil, and Nadia Kossinskaja.

Personal contacts were instrumental in inviting artists for the festival, with few going through management. Rolf Stahlhofen, co-founder of Sohnemannheims, expresses his gratitude towards Fools Garden, stating that their music is widely recognised around the world.

Tickets for the festival will go on sale starting Saturday, November 4, 2023. A ticket for all three festival days costs 149 euros and includes a VIP ticket with "Meet and Greet" on August 2. For those preferring to attend a single day, tickets cost 59 euros. For persons in wheelchairs, disabled persons with a disability of 60% or more, and holders of the Pforzheim Pass, the discounted day price of 39 euros applies in advance sales.

The festival will also feature a tombola for charitable purposes, with all proceeds going to the "Water is Right" foundation and "People in Need." The Painters' Hall will serve as a lounge for meetings on both days during the festival.
